Spécifications

Attribut Valeur
PartStatus Active
AmplifierType Standard (General Purpose)
NumberofCircuits 1
OutputType Rail-to-Rail
SlewRate 1.5V/µs
GainBandwidthProduct 3 MHz
Current-InputBias 0.2 pA
Voltage-InputOffset 500 µV
Current-Supply 150µA
Current-Output/Channel 20 mA
Voltage-SupplySpan(Min) 1.8 V
Voltage-SupplySpan(Max) 5.5 V
OperatingTemperature -40°C ~ 125°C
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case SC-74A, SOT-753
SupplierDevicePackage SOT-23-5
BaseProductNumber OPA314
Grade Automotive
Qualification AEC-Q100
